Pennsylvania - Allegheny County Ban the Box Law

Allegheny County has a Ban the Box policy for County employment applications. The County does not inquire about criminal history until after it has made a conditional offer of employment. The county conducts background checks for specific positions and applies EEOC factors to evaluate an applicant's criminal history, taking into account relevant factors. These factors include the nature of the conviction, the length of time since the conviction, the job duties, and evidence of rehabilitation.
